Biotinylated isoxazole 95% Chemical Properties
Boiling point 800.4±65.0 °C(Predicted)
density 1.251±0.06 g/cm3(Predicted)
storage temp. -20°C
solubility Soluble in DMSO (30 mg/ml with warming)
form powder or crystals
pka13.77±0.46(Predicted)
color Beige
Stability:Stable for 2 years as supplied. Solutions in DMSO may be stored at -20°C for up to 1 month.

Biotinylated isoxazole 95% Usage And Synthesis
DescriptionBiotin-isoxazole (1377605-22-5) precipitates hundreds of RNA-binding proteins with significant overlap to the constituents of RNA granules.1,2 In one study roughly 580 nuclear proteins were identified as being precipitated by B-Isox including TAF15, RNA polymerase II (largest subunit), numerous subunits of the mediator complex as well as a variety of enzymes involved in epigenetic modification of histones.3? SR domains were found to be the determinant that facilitates B-Isox precipitation.4 Also allows for the fractionation / isolation of SG-associated proteins and RNA precipitates.5
UsesWhen exposed to cells or tissue lysates, biotinylated isoxazole (b-isox) was shown to precipitate RNA-binding proteins with significant overlap to the components of RNA granules. By reversibly aggregating and disaggregating structures similar to RNA granules, b-isox has lent insight to polypeptides necessary for the reversible aggregation of RNA-binding proteins.This product was previously listed as T511617.
